Broken Glass

It is essential to fix a cracked window pane as soon as you can. This will stop the crack from forming the form of a spider's web, and will keep water, cold and other debris out of the house. Many times, homeowners can repair the cracks without having to replace the entire window.

To begin, the broken glass should be removed from the frame. This can be accomplished by hand with a putty knife or another deglazing tools. It is recommended to wear protective gloves and eye protection when handling broken glass. Once the glass is removed, it should be stored in a safe location before it is disposed of.

After taking off the old sealant and the glazing points, the frame needs to be thoroughly cleaned using a wire bristle and damp cloth. Then apply a hair dryer or heat gun to soften any remaining sealant. This will make it easier to remove. Once the frame is cleaned, it is a good idea to apply a small amount linseed oil to the rabbet grooves, where the new glass will go to ensure that it sticks to the frame.

Then cut the glass to the appropriate size to ensure that it fits in the frame. If the gap is very large, a piece of glass repair film could be used to fill in the gap and hold the new glass in position. If the gap is less then you can apply a piece of clear tape or concealing film on both sides of it to prevent it from expanding.

After the glass has been cut to size, it can be inserted into the frame that is empty and secured by using either putty or glazing. It is then a good idea apply any paint that may be needed on the frame. If the glass is framed with wood molding, it is important to ensure that these pieces are removed before installing the new window pane since they may be damaged by the removal and replacement of the window.

Condensation

Double glazing is known to cause condensation. If condensation is present, you should ventilate the room as often as possible, especially during times of high humidity. This will help to reduce condensation. A dehumidifier is also useful. If you don't manage to keep condensation at bay you should seek out a professional to fix your windows as quickly as possible. This is because a buildup of condensation can cause black mould, which could pose a serious health risk.

If you don't get your double glazed window repaired can leave you with damaged or deteriorating frames and the gaps that insulate the glass panes will be compromised. This will let cold air into your home and affect the thermal efficiency of the unit.

It is worth contacting the company that fitted your double glazing repairs near me glazing to see whether they offer warranty support since they might be able to repair or replace your windows for free particularly if you bought the units recently. You should also contact them to find out if they can offer suggestions and guidance on how to prevent condensation in the future.

Use a non-abrasive material such as cerium dioxide or iron oxide, which you can apply with a cloth. You can then clean the window's surface until it is dry.

Another option is to drill tiny holes into your double-glazed windows and then putting the desiccant inside. This will help to absorb any moisture which has accumulated between the glass panes. This is a great short-term solution. However it is crucial to keep in mind that the condensation should disappear when the hole is been sealed once more.

Experts are usually able to solve the problem of condensation by sealing the draught or by replacing the seal on the inside of the window. It is possible to repair the damaged seal, however in some cases they may recommend replacing the entire window. If there is a lot of condensation on the exterior of your window, you may be advised to replace the entire frame.

Misting

Double glazing is a worthwhile investment for any home, as it keeps your home warm and absorbing the outside noise. It can also help you save money by boosting the efficiency of your home's energy usage. However, if your double glazed windows start to get cloudy it's crucial to act swiftly to avoid further damage.

The misting can be a sign that the seal has failed between the two panes, causing water between the windows. This could be a difficult issue to resolve. The best solution is to call an expert window installer to replace the double-glazed sealed unit.

To prevent the formation of condensation in your double glazed windows, it is recommended to wash them regularly. This will keep them in good condition and extend their life span. For the best results it's recommended to use a vacuum with a brush attachment. focus on areas that are prone to accumulating dirt.

It is possible to maintain the appearance of your windows by having them professionally cleaned. It also helps prevent the build-up of grime that may cause the seals to weaken and let moisture in. You can also try to get rid of the fog yourself by spraying a bottle that contains anti-fog fluid. However, this can be lengthy and requires drilling holes into the double-glazing window. This method is not recommended unless the DIYer is highly experienced.

If windows with double glazing are still covered by warranty, you should contact the installers to ask for replacement. In most instances, the company can repair or replace the sealed units and provide a warranty on the new windows.

Double-glazed windows that have been blown occur when the seal cracks between the two panes which allows cold air to pass through the window, and warm air to escape. This leaves the spacer bar inside the glass with condensation that eventually forms creating a misty appearance. While it is possible to repair blown double glazed windows by replacing the glass unit, it does not solve the condensation that is already inside the window.

Broken Frame

If the frame of your double glazed window is damaged, you'll need to replace it. Find a local glass manufacturer. They will sell new frames at a reasonable price and install them quickly. They can also answer any questions you may have. They will also be able to advise you on the best window for your home.

The first step is to take the window panes that are currently on the frame. If you wear gloves and carefully remove each piece of glass, Double glazing repairs this can be done by hand. This will stop the cracks from spreading. Then, put the glass in a container or another container that is suitable to ensure safe disposal.

Next, you'll need remove the old putty that's keeping the glass in place. You can either chisel it away or use a heat gun to soften it. After the putty has been removed it is possible to remove any nails and clips in the frame, and then clean the wood with a wire brush until it's free of paint and dirt.

Reassembling your double-glazed window frame can be done after the wood has been cleaned and sanded. It's also painted with a protective sealer. Make use of a caulkgun to apply a thin silicone sealant to the frame's edges, both inside and Double glazing repairs outside. This will block out the elements and keep the buildup of moisture that can cause damage to frames and the frame to rot.

After the caulk has been applied, you can begin to fit the glass into the frame. The glass points are made of metal triangular triangles which hold glass in position. They should be pushed hard into the frame, and pressed against the glazing or putty to ensure they don't shift. Then you can apply additional glaziers' compounds to the frame and glass, and let it dry before painting. This is to be done in a manner that matches the other windows in your home. It is also necessary to add any molding or trim that was taken off when the frame was dismantled.
